#8b5884 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8b5884 is composed of 54.5% red, 34.5%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.7% magenta, 5%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 308.2 degrees, a saturation of 22.5% and a lightness of 44.5%. #8b5884 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b0ff with #170009.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#8b5884 color description : Mostly desaturated dark magenta.

#8b5884 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8b5884 has RGB values of R:139, G:88,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.05,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9132164.

Shades and Tints of #8b5884

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070407 is the darkest color, while #fcfaf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8b5884

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a6977 is the less saturated color, while #e201c3 is the most saturated one.
